I had the rubble problem myself when I first tried TTW. I 'fixed' it for lack of a better word by getting the refs for all the offending rubble bits using the console. Then marking them as deleted using fnvedit.
Marking them as initially disabled is what TTW does and it 'should' work really, it just doesn't for some people. Marking those bits of rubble as deleted though just effing nukes them, they don't come back from that. :P

This is essentially what the plugin does: it sets up an activator outside of the metro cell which disables the relevant objects.
If it isn't working for some people then we'd really like to know why. 'Nuking' the references from the plugin using edit is a dirty workaround and it doesn't help us understand this issue any better.
